Ray tracing is my friend now! In preparation to the upcoming animations, I've started reworking one of my environments, starting with the Forest Pass from the recent Encounter 2 animation. I'm planning on using the environment in next month's mini animation that will feature Bunsen and Space Hero.
Fully converting the environment was a tad easier since the background was already using Redshift shaders, the foreground however was still using the old rasterized render engine, which had quite a lot of shortcomings when it came to lighting and the rendering of vegetation. The greenery is now using proper subsurface materials with fancy backlighting, something that wasn't possible previously due to the lack of support of SSS with alpha materials.

To get a bit more familiar with Ornatrix, I've been making fur maps for a lot of the environment assets to simulate moss. I'm still improving the material shader itself, which is pretty good training for remaking Zoe's fur later down the line. I'm anticipating for it to look a big step up from the previous fur model due to some new shading parameters such as scattering and reflection, which will allow me to add proper light scattering and wetness properties to fur/hair shaders.
I'm still unertain on which lighting mood I'll be going for for next month's mini animation, but it will likely either the sunny one, or the one with the moody early morning lighting. For the animation I might also be using some fancy volumetric effects, such as steam coming from Bunsen's maw. I've used an effect like this in the past for Zoe's maw, but it was mostly a layered smoke effect in post that I sometimes combined with a 3D depth channel to make it a bit more convincing. There's already some volumetrics in in these renders, including 3D clouds, which will probably become standard for future animations as well.
